九份的老街總是喧鬧的,遊人的腳步聲、店家的吆喝聲,一層層疊在山城的階梯上。而「謐所」藏身在老街中後段,恰好是喧囂漸漸淡去、山風開始接手的地方。而此建築的動線,其實是一場心境的遞減:從街道的日常聲響出發,途經一方得以喘息的前院;最終,落腳於幽深靜謐的臥室。像是把「回家」這件事,拆成了三段呼吸,正是遠囂尋幽的三個層次,一步步把喧鬧留在身後。
推開門前,先遇見的是一方素白的前院,建築外觀以白色打底、木質點綴其間,中央一座玻璃屋悄悄外推,兩側則以實牆守住私密——虛與實在此交界,讓旅人尚未進門,便已舒心,忘卻方才喧囂。
室內共十六坪,一樓與夾層層疊而上,與建築外觀彼此呼應。從右側入內,迎面是一間長型寬闊的起居室:前段是水泥地,微涼、平整,是旅客卸下裝備與心事的玄關過渡;往後兩階微微抬升,木地板便接手了溫度,將空間輕輕過渡進和室般的休憩氛圍。右側設有木作茶水吧檯,備有迎賓茶點,供旅人在坐定之前,先啜一口暖意。沙發旁,是團隊親手打造、木座搭配金屬架構的書報架,靜靜候著一段閱讀的午後。空間後方開了一扇窗,映出建築後方天然石牆的紋理,自成一幅山水畫。全室採用暖光間照,光線沿著牆面水平線緩緩爬向屋頂,在轉角處暈開一道三角形的光,像是山城夜裡,被輕輕點亮的一盞燈。
起居室一側緊接著客餐廳。前方以玻璃帷幕圍出一方半戶外的觀景區,一座金屬柴燒暖爐靜靜立於其中。冬日裡,柴火劈啪作響,旅人圍爐而坐,窗外是九份層疊的屋瓦與遠山,窗內是跳動的火光,欣賞聲光之間的對話。從戶外望入,圓桌後方是一扇白色的圓窗,仿中式蘇州庭院的造景語彙,框架出一方安靜的留白。圓窗之後,正是臥室,旅人枕邊入夢前,仍能透過那一圈弧線,窺見窗外天色由暮轉夜,由夜轉曉。這扇窗,像是為睡眠留了一道縫隙,讓外面的世界,不至於完全被隔絕。
客餐廳左側,前方是一片半戶外的植栽區,後方則是廁所與泡澡區,整區緊貼著建築後方的天然岩壁而建,未經修飾的石紋成了最原始的壁景。泡澡時,彷彿不是待在一方浴室裡,而是大自然環抱著,十分療癒。
起居室與客餐廳之間,一座仿鷹架結構的樓梯拔地而起,線條利落。旅人踩著木質踏階,一步步拾級而上,便能抵達閣樓裡的小房間,那是整棟建築最靠近天空的所在。推開房門之外,另有一方觀景露台,九份的山巒層層疊疊地展開,白日看雲,夜裡數燈火。

Jiufen Old Street is known for its lively atmosphere. The footsteps of visitors and the calls of shopkeepers weave together along the mountain pathways, forming the unmistakable character of the town. Hidden within the latter section of the old street, however, Jiufen Sanctuary occupies a unique threshold—where the bustle gradually fades and the mountain breeze begins to take over.
The circulation of the project was designed as a gradual emotional transition. From the sounds of the street, visitors pass through a calming front courtyard before arriving at the secluded bedroom beyond. The experience unfolds like three measured breaths, each step drawing guests further away from the noise of daily life and closer to a sense of quiet retreat.
Before entering the interior, guests are welcomed by a simple white courtyard. The building is defined by white surfaces accented with warm timber details. A glass volume subtly projects outward from the center, while solid walls on either side preserve privacy. Here, openness and enclosure exist in balance, allowing visitors to leave the outside world behind before even crossing the threshold.
Occupying approximately 53 square meters, the retreat is arranged across a ground floor and mezzanine level, reflecting the layered composition of the exterior architecture. Entering from the right, guests arrive in an elongated living area. The entrance zone is finished with exposed concrete flooring—cool, smooth, and grounding—serving as a transitional space where travelers can set down both their belongings and their thoughts. Two shallow steps lead upward to a timber floor, introducing warmth and gently shifting the atmosphere toward a Japanese-inspired living environment.
Alongside the living space sits a custom-built tea bar offering welcome refreshments, inviting guests to pause and settle into the experience. Beside the sofa, a handcrafted bookshelf with timber bases and a metal framework, designed and fabricated by the team, provides a quiet corner for reading and contemplation. At the rear of the room, a carefully positioned window frames the texture of the site's natural stone wall, transforming it into a living landscape painting.
Warm indirect lighting is integrated throughout the interior. Light traces the horizontal lines of the walls before gradually extending upward across the ceiling, where soft triangular washes emerge at the corners—reminiscent of a lantern gently illuminating the mountain town at night.
Adjacent to the living room is the dining and gathering space. Enclosed by floor-to-ceiling glass, a semi-outdoor viewing lounge creates a place to engage with the surrounding landscape. At its center stands a metal wood-burning stove. During winter, the crackling sound of firewood fills the room as guests gather around the hearth. Beyond the glass, the layered rooftops and distant mountains of Jiufen unfold; within, flickering firelight creates a quiet dialogue between light, sound, and scenery.
Viewed from outside, a white circular window appears behind the dining table. Inspired by the framed vistas of traditional Suzhou gardens, it introduces a deliberate moment of visual stillness. Beyond the circular opening lies the bedroom, where guests can watch the changing sky transition from dusk to night and from night to dawn. The window preserves a subtle connection to the landscape, allowing the outside world to remain present without disturbing the intimacy of rest.
To the left of the dining area, a semi-outdoor planting zone brings nature deeper into the interior. Behind it are the bathroom and bathing areas, positioned directly against the site's natural rock face. The untouched stone surface becomes the space's most authentic backdrop. Bathing here feels less like occupying a room and more like being immersed within the landscape itself, offering a deeply restorative experience.
Between the living area and dining space, a staircase inspired by scaffold structures rises with clean and refined lines. Ascending the timber treads leads to a loft room positioned at the highest point of the retreat—the place closest to the sky. Beyond the room, an outdoor viewing terrace opens toward Jiufen's layered mountain scenery, offering cloud-filled vistas by day and scattered hillside lights by night.
